Directions : In each question below is given a statement followed by two conclusions numbered I and II. You have to assume everything in the statement to be true, even if they are at variance with the commonly known facts. Then consider the two conclusions together ignoring the commonly known facts and decide which of them logically follows beyond a reasonable doubt from the information given in the statement give answer.
Statement: Unity is hindered by gaps among the people on the basis of economy, culture religion and language. Conclusion:
I. Unity is a must for the Country.
II. Any country where there are such gaps will find it difficult to stay united.
If only conclusion I follows.
If only conclusion II follows.
If either I or II follows.
If neither I nor II follows.
If both I and II follows.
Only Conclusion II follows.
